Làm cách nào để chuyển đầu ra âm thanh từ Mac OS X sang Ubuntu qua mạng?


12

Có thể bằng cách nào đó chạm vào đầu ra âm thanh và gửi nó qua mạng đến một máy khác. Các định dạng có thể không tương thích, nhưng tôi sẽ đánh giá cao ngay cả về một số thông tin về cách nhấn vào âm thanh trên Mac OS X!

Câu trả lời:


5

Tôi đã nghiên cứu một giải pháp tốt cho vấn đề này vào đầu năm nay, nhưng vẫn chưa có cách tốt nhất.

Phần đầu tiên bạn có thể sẽ cần là Soundflower . Điều này sẽ cho phép bạn rút kỹ thuật số ra khỏi máy Mac của mình và lặp nó sang nguồn kỹ thuật số mới.

Phần tôi thiếu là cách tốt nhất để phát sóng đầu vào kỹ thuật số sang máy khác.

Có thể thực hiện điều này thông qua ESounD, Pulse hoặc Jack, nhưng tôi không quen với việc triển khai chúng và đây không phải là ưu tiên cao nhất của tôi.

Một cách khác mà tôi đang xem xét là sử dụng VLC, bằng cách nào đó lấy Soundflower như thể nó là đầu vào micrô hoặc đầu vào và xuất bản một luồng âm thanh, sau đó kết nối với luồng này từ Ubuntu, tức là tại http://192.168.0.2:8000 .

Tuy nhiên, bạn đã đạt được nó, tôi hy vọng rằng câu trả lời này đã giúp bạn phù hợp với một mảnh của câu đố này.


Cảm ơn liên kết đến Soundflower ... Xem, bây giờ tôi đang nghĩ về một số cách sử dụng hợp pháp (cho bản thân tôi) cho việc này; ít nhất, đối với Soundflower. Thật tệ, tôi không phải là máy Mac. Phải tham khảo ý kiến ​​tuyệt vời của Oracle về một cái gì đó tương tự cho Winders hoặc Linux.
Adrien

PulseAudio hỗ trợ linux và win32 gốc và bạn có thể định cấu hình nó hoạt động như thế này. Tôi không thể tìm thấy cổng mac của PulseAudio, nhưng chỉ là phiên bản cũ hơn được gọi là esound, có thể hoạt động với PulseAudio. Cảm ơn bạn mpbloch!
JtR

Nếu bạn đi theo lộ trình VLC, URL đầu vào bạn muốn là qtsound: // SoundFlower: 0. Nếu điều đó không hoạt động, hãy sử dụng qtsound: // để lấy mặc định (có thể là mic) và xem nhật ký thông báo để biết danh sách các đầu vào qtsound: // thay thế.
RobM

5

Nếu bạn đang tìm kiếm một giải pháp đóng gói độc đáo thì tôi muốn phần mềm Airfoil của Rogue Amoeba để làm việc này. Tôi sử dụng nó từ Mac đến Mac (nó sử dụng Soundflower dưới vỏ bọc, cho một phần của mánh khóe, nhưng cũng là "Cướp biển tức thời" của riêng họ để lấy âm thanh từ các ứng dụng đã chạy) và nó hoạt động rất tốt.

loa Airfoil - chỉ có các ứng dụng miễn phí cho Mac, Windows, Linux và iPhone, ngoài ra nó có thể gửi âm thanh đến Airport Express.



2

Nicecast của Rogue Amoeba sẽ làm điều đó cho bạn. Nó có giá, nhưng không nhiều. US $ 40. Họ có một phiên bản dùng thử. Tôi không chắc chắn về những hạn chế của thử nghiệm.

Icecast là một tùy chọn miễn phí, nhưng nó thiếu tính độc đáo vượt trội của Nicecast.


2

Với XBMC được cài đặt trên máy Linux và không có bất kỳ phần mềm nào khác trên máy Mac của tôi, tôi có thể truyền phát bất cứ thứ gì tôi muốn (tôi chạy nó trong Debian để nó cũng hoạt động trong Ubuntu).

Để làm điều này:

  1. Định cấu hình XBMC làm máy thu Airplay: đi tới Hệ thống> Dịch vụ> Airplay và bật Airplay (Tôi không sử dụng mật khẩu)
  2. Trên máy Mac của bạn, mở Cài đặt âm thanh Midi
  3. Nhấp chuột phải vào mục Airplay ở phía bên trái và chọn Khác Sử dụng thiết bị này để phát âm thanh ra từ menu bật lên Hành động.

Bây giờ, mọi thứ bạn chơi trên máy Mac sẽ xuất ra thiết bị Airplay của bạn.

Để quay ngược trở lại đầu ra bình thường (ví dụ trên MacBook), nhấp chuột phải vào đầu ra khác (ví dụ: loa tiêu chuẩn hoặc đầu ra tích hợp) và chọn Sử dụng thiết bị này cho đầu ra âm thanh, từ menu bật lên Hành động.

Xem thêm: Cài đặt âm thanh Midi: Thiết lập thiết bị âm thanh của bạn


1

Nếu bạn không bị ràng buộc với bất kỳ ứng dụng âm thanh cụ thể nào ở cuối Mac, tôi khuyên bạn nên sử dụng VLC Media Player . Nó có thể hoạt động như kho phát nhạc và danh sách phát của Macintosh, bộ phát âm thanh kỹ thuật số của Mac và bộ thu / phát âm thanh phát trực tuyến cho hệ thống Ubuntu cung cấp năng lượng cho các loa tốt.

Có những lợi thế khi sử dụng VLC bên cạnh việc tránh phải kết hợp các chức năng của một số chương trình. Vì VLC cung cấp các tệp nhị phân được biên dịch sẵn cho các hệ điều hành từ BeOS đến Zaurus, cũng như mã nguồn cho (gần) mọi thứ khác, bạn có thể dễ dàng thích ứng với các thay đổi trong hệ điều hành hoặc thiết lập phần cứng trong tương lai mà không phải lo lắng về khả năng tương thích. Hơn nữa, VLC có thể phát mọi định dạng mà bạn có thể có trong tay - hoặc có thể đã từng nghe về vấn đề đó.



1

Cập nhật cho người tìm kiếm:

Nhìn vào shairport-sync, bạn có thể chạy nó trên Linux / Ubuntu để thiết lập máy chủ Airplay được OSX nhận ra một cách vui vẻ và bạn có thể định cấu hình một số phụ trợ để xử lý âm thanh mà nó nhận được, chẳng hạn như gửi nó đến loa kết thúc Linux / Ubuntu.


Tôi thấy hướng dẫn này rất hữu ích: forum.htmlpcguides.com/ từ
David Ljung Madison Stellar

0

Nếu bạn đang tìm cách truyền phát tệp âm thanh của mình, có một tỷ phương pháp. Âm thanh như, tuy nhiên, bạn có một nguồn âm thanh cụ thể mà bạn muốn phát ra. Bạn có thể giải thích về điều đó?


Tôi muốn chuyển tiếp mọi thứ mà hệ thống mac sẽ tự phát trên loa của nó. Nó sẽ giống như bộ loa mới.
JtR

-1

Có vẻ như bạn đang hỏi liệu có thể truyền âm thanh được kết xuất qua mạng không.

Không phải không có chuyển đổi A / D khác, và một số cách để chuyển nó xuống cấp độ Ethernet và phần mềm phù hợp ở phía bên kia.

Bạn có thể sửa lại câu hỏi của bạn để giải thích những gì bạn đang thực sự làm không? Chúng ta có thể hữu ích hơn sau đó.

Nếu bạn đang cố gắng bảo vệ các tệp AAC DRM-ed của mình khỏi iTunes, điều đó có thể được thực hiện, nhưng không ai ở đây sẽ cho bạn biết làm thế nào.


Bạn có thể bắt được âm thanh trước khi nó chạm vào loa bằng cách sử dụng Soundflower. Xem liên kết trong câu trả lời của tôi. Điều này sẽ giữ nó ở định dạng kỹ thuật số để bạn làm bất cứ điều gì với, nhưng "bất cứ điều gì" là gì, tôi không biết.
maxwellb

Tôi muốn sử dụng máy tính mac làm nguồn âm thanh cho loa tốt hơn của máy tính chính của mình. Tôi sẽ không gặp rắc rối khi thoát khỏi DRM theo cách này mà chỉ tải xuống từ piratebay, nhận xét ngu ngốc.
JtR

Chính xác thì điều gì là ngu ngốc khi chỉ ra rằng đây không phải là một trang web "warez"?
Adrien

Chính xác là tôi đã không hỏi bất cứ điều gì liên quan đến "warez".
JtR

Vâng, tôi xin lỗi vì đã xúc phạm bạn; tuy nhiên, "d00d, làm cách nào để bẻ khóa sản phẩm xyz " là một câu hỏi rất phổ biến và tôi quyết định quá cay độc.
Adrien
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.